We are now looking for a Compliance Operations Analyst to grow our compliance team in our London office. The ideal candidate will be open-minded, gregarious, detail-oriented, and capable of articulating data-driven opinions. The role is essential in managing risks around our customers, including conducting checks on customer accounts in line with our SOF/SOW policies and leading efforts to ensure customer spend is affordable.
In this role, you will act as a subject matter expert on customer documentation analysis, ensuring our customers are crime-free and gambling responsibly. You should have a strong understanding of our policies on affordability and know when to escalate customers to the AML team.
About You
- Experience conducting customer reviews and analysis, ideally in financial services or gambling sectors
- Strong knowledge of verifying Source of Wealth and Source of Funds
- Understanding of regulatory frameworks relevant to online gambling, including money laundering and terrorist financing typologies
- Awareness of policies related to customer affordability and safer gambling
- Attention to detail and experience analyzing customer documents
- Ability to evaluate complex issues and exercise sound judgment
- Professional certifications such as ICA or ACAMS are advantageous
